Description
Did the three Japanese teenage girls in Babymetal just one-up every current metalcore and deathcore band with their infectious blend of J-pop and metal? Chuck and Godless debate that very topic in this week's podcast. Gravy the Stuttering Insult Comic makes a guest appearance with a dead-on review of Megadeth's new album.
Chuck and Godless also cover the latest headlines, including the lineup for the Housecore Horror Film Festival, Protest the Hero hiring Lamb of God's Chris Adler as a fill-in drummer, Dillinger Escape Plan guitarist Ben Weinman's broken hand and Dave Mustaine's latest profane stage-rant against a fan.
Playlist:
Megadeth - "Built For War"Chthonic – "Supreme Pain for the Tyrant"Babymetal - "Megitsune"Chelsea Grin – "Right Now" (Korn cover)Fuck the Facts – "Vent Du Nord"
